At the apex of this financial pyramid sits a name that's quickly become synonymous with hockey wealth: Henry Samueli. According to Forbes, Samueli, the owner of the Anaheim Ducks, was worth around $3.5 billion in 2020. Fast forward five years, and his estimated net worth has exploded, reaching an astounding $20 billion. This rapid ascent, according to sources, positions Samueli as the richest NHL owner, eclipsing even seasoned investors like Stan Kroenke. The timing of Samueli's wealth accumulation has been nothing short of exceptional, coinciding with a period of unprecedented growth in the hockey world.

Attribute Details
Full Name Henry Samueli
Net Worth (approx.) $20.86 Billion (as of recent estimates)
Source of Wealth Co-founder of Broadcom Inc. & NHL Ownership
Born March 16, 1954 (Age 70)
Nationality American
Residence Newport Beach, California
Education Ph.D. in Electrical Engineering from UCLA
Current Affiliations Owner of the Anaheim Ducks, Professor on leave at UCLA
Anaheim Ducks Purchase Price Approximately $70 million (2005)
Current Team Value $1.3 billion (approximate)
Key Business Ventures Co-founded Broadcom Inc., a major semiconductor company; real estate investments; philanthropic activities.
Spouse Susan Samueli
Children Yes

The story of Henry Samueli and the Anaheim Ducks is a compelling one. He and his wife, Susan, acquired the team in 2005 for an estimated $70 million. Today, the franchise is valued at an impressive $1.3 billion, a testament to Samueli's astute business acumen and his ability to capitalize on the growing popularity of hockey. This remarkable return on investment underscores the financial opportunities available in the NHL, making it an attractive proposition for those with the capital and vision to succeed.

The presence of so many billionaires in the NHL begs the question: how did they amass their fortunes? The sources of wealth are as diverse as the owners themselves. Henry Samueli's wealth stems from his co-founding of Broadcom Inc., a major semiconductor company. Others, like Kroenke, have made their fortunes in real estate and media, while others have built investment empires.
